Jelani Aliyu, hails from Sokoto State, Nigeria and is General Motors Lead Exterior Designer and the designer of the Chevy Volt. General Motors is the world’s largest automobile maker. The car has been described as an American Revolution and one of the hottest concepts in the design line. Jelani was born in 1966 in Kaduna, to Alhaji Aliya Haidara and Sharifiya Hauwa’u Aliyu. The fifth of seven children, theirs is a very close-knit family. For him, it was an amazing experience growing up in Sokoto, surrounded by the rich culture of the people and the state and enjoying excellent access to the latest and international information From 1971 to 1978, he attended Capital School, Sokoto, an excellent school and this served as a very productive educational experience for him. In 1978, he gained admission into Federal Government College, Sokoto, from where he graduated in 1983 with an award as the best in Technical Drawing. Jelani was privileged to meet and make many good friends from all parts of the country and beyond during this time. He had tremendous encouragement and mentoring from his family and friends and his creative art develop the ed. He drew a lot, designed his own cars, and even built scale models of them, complete with exteriors and interiors. After FGC, he got admission into the Ahmadu Bello University, Zaria to study Architecture, but soon discovered that curriculum did not support his future vision and plans. After considering other institutions in Nigeria and their academic programmes, he concluded that only one of them had the study criteria that would support his future goals. The institution in which he chose to pursue his education was one he felt offered the best creative programmes and had experience that would give him the best foundation required to study Automobile Design abroad. That institution was the Birnin Kebbi Polytechnic. He was there from 1986 to 1988 and earned an associate degree in Architecture, with an award as Best All-Round Student. While there, he did some in depth research into home design and construction, looking into materials and structures that would be most compatible with our environment and climate; buildings that would stay cool in a hot environment with little, or no artificial electrical air conditioning. Upon graduation from the polytechnic, Jelani worked for a while at the Ministry of Works, Sokoto. In 1990, Aliyu moved to Detroit, Michigan to enroll at the College for Creative Studies in Detroit under a Sokoto Schorlarship board sponsorship. Having always wanted to study Automobile Design, this was a dream come true and an absolutely fascinating experience. The course was very practical and emphasis was put on creativity and the development of new designs to provide solutions . He received his degree in automobile design in 1994. In 1994 he began his career with the design staff of General Motors. He worked on the Buick Rendezvous and was the lead exterior designer of the Pontiac G6. He also worked on the Astra with General Motors’ Opel Division. Here are the two things that "I" think is going on. The thread title says "Meet Jelani Aliyu, Nigerian Genius Who Designed Chevrolet Volt". 1) On Nairaland and perhaps Nigeria posters like to use superlatives like hot, stunning, sexiest, etc. i think the word genius perhaps is throwing off a lot of people. No one single Engineer is a genius in a company like GM. Even companies like Apple who has very senior designers still work with a team. So the use of the word genius makes it seem like he single handedly created the Volt. At least in my opinion. 2) The subjects title is Lead Designer. In the US, and in most fortune companies, the title of a Lead doesn't mean that you are the one and only. In a management chain, the Director of design, for example, amy not necessarily want to interact with every single employee on many teams that he oversees, so he will simply appoint one of them the Lead. Very common. This Lead may actually not even doing any design work and may have been sidelined into doing administrative duties mostly. So a Lead Designer having proven himself to GM as an exceptional designer may end up doing only fine tuning, approving, improving designs that are submitted to him by his team mates before presenting it to upper management. This may be the "middle management" curse.
